An Atkins low-carb side inspired by a pasta favorite.
Ingredients
Directions
- Boil green beans in a quart of water until they start to get tender.
- Drain green beans and place them in a medium baking dish. Set aside. Heat oven to 350 °F (175 °C).
- In a saucepan, heat olive oil on medium heat.
- Throw in minced garlic and stir until slightly browned, add heavy cream and cream cheese.
- Break up cream cheese with spatula. Keep stirring until cream cheese is mostly melted. Remove from heat, stir in the parmesan cheese.
- Pour cheese mixture over green beans and stir to coat.
- Place in 350 °F oven for 20 minutes, stirring every 5 minutes.
- Let cool about 10 minutes before serving. Salt and pepper to taste.
